The cupric nitrate formula, represented by Cu(NO3)2, is straightforward but powerful. With a molar mass around 187.56 g/mol and a density close to 2.32 g/cm³, its composition makes it both reactive and manageable.
When dealing with pure forms versus solution grades, small differences in purity and concentration often lead to large impacts in finishing processes. For instance, cupric nitrate solution, commonly supplied at concentrations between 10% to 25%, gives a balance between safety and effectiveness—vital in industries like metal treatment, pigment manufacturing, or ceramics.
Safety remains a top concern: The NFPA (National Fire Protection Association) ratings stand as a quick way to scan hazard levels. For copper II nitrate NFPA, I’ve seen its health rating average at 2, flammability at 0, and reactivity at 2. These numbers steer chemical safety officers toward proper storage, handling, and emergency procedures.

Cupric nitrate uses go well beyond the classroom or lab. In my stint with a major ceramics manufacturer, workers relied on Cupric Nitrate Solution Brand: CopperMax Model: CN-50 for coloring glass and producing special glazes. The blue or green hues that show up in luxury tiles often trace back directly to precise nitrate dosing.
In the metal sector, fabricators use cupric nitrate for etching and patination. This includes preserving ancient statues and creating modern art pieces with custom finishes.
